在数字化时代,编程已经成为一项至关重要的技能。无论是从事软件开发、数据分析,还是人工智能等领域,高效整合代码都是提高工作效率、保证项目质量的关键。下面,我将从多个角度分享一些编程技巧,帮助大家轻松实现代码的高效整合。
1. 选择合适的编程语言
首先,选择一门适合自己项目需求的编程语言至关重要。不同的编程语言有着不同的特点和适用场景。例如,Python适合快速开发,Java适合企业级应用,C++适合性能要求高的系统。了解并选择合适的编程语言,是高效整合代码的第一步。
2. 熟练掌握编程规范
编程规范是保证代码质量、提高团队协作效率的基础。熟练掌握编程规范,可以使代码更加清晰、易读、易维护。以下是一些常见的编程规范:
- 命名规范:变量、函数、类等命名应具有描述性,避免使用缩写。
- 代码格式:使用一致的缩进、空格和换行,使代码更具可读性。
- 注释:合理添加注释,解释代码的意图和实现方式。
3. 利用版本控制工具
版本控制工具(如Git)可以帮助我们管理代码的版本,方便团队成员之间的协作。熟练使用版本控制工具,可以轻松实现代码的合并、分支管理、代码审查等功能。
4. 学习设计模式
设计模式是解决软件开发中常见问题的经验总结。掌握常见的设计模式,可以使代码更加模块化、可复用,提高代码质量。以下是一些常用的设计模式:
- 单例模式:确保一个类只有一个实例,并提供一个全局访问点。
- 工厂模式:创建对象实例的过程由工厂类控制,降低模块间的耦合度。
- 观察者模式:当一个对象的状态发生变化时,其他依赖该对象的对象会自动收到通知。
5. 优化代码性能
代码性能是衡量程序优劣的重要指标。以下是一些优化代码性能的技巧:
- 避免重复计算:利用缓存、记忆化等手段,避免重复计算。
- 减少内存占用:合理使用数据结构,减少内存占用。
- 并行计算:利用多线程、多进程等技术,提高程序执行效率。
6. 学习代码审查技巧
代码审查是保证代码质量的重要环节。以下是一些代码审查的技巧:
- 关注代码逻辑:检查代码逻辑是否正确,是否符合需求。
- 关注代码风格:检查代码风格是否符合规范,是否易于阅读。
- 关注代码性能:检查代码性能是否满足要求。
7. 持续学习和实践
编程是一门实践性很强的技能。只有不断学习、实践,才能提高自己的编程水平。以下是一些建议:
- 阅读优秀代码:学习他人的编程经验,提高自己的编程水平。
- 参与开源项目:通过参与开源项目,提高自己的团队协作能力和解决问题的能力。
- 编写技术博客:总结自己的编程经验,分享给他人。
通过以上技巧,相信大家能够轻松实现代码的高效整合,提高自己的编程水平。让我们一起努力,成为优秀的程序员吧!
